Telecast Fiber Systems Launches CopperHead™ Visa

Camera-Mounted Fiber Transceiver Provides News Gatherers With a Direct Link Between HD Cameras and Third-Party TX/RX

Telecast Fiber Systems today announced the launch of the CopperHead™ Visa, the latest member of the company's industry-leading CopperHead family of camera-mounted fiber optic transceiver systems. The CopperHead Visa provides a smooth and seamless fiber optic link between remotely deployed HD news gathering cameras and any third-party transmit/receive and audio embedder/de-embedder systems, such as the Evertz Video PassPort™.

Unlike other CopperHead transceivers, the patented CopperHead Visa requires no base station — instead, it provides a direct fiber optic link between the HD camera and the video processing unit installed in the truck. The CopperHead Visa takes the camera's video and embedded audio signals and transforms them into optical signals, where they are carried on fiber cable across a distance of more than 5,000 feet without any loss of signal quality. A video processing system like the Evertz PassPort in the truck then transforms the optical signals back into video and de-embeds the audio. That same processing device simultaneously sends a return video feed, with embedded IFB audio, back to the CopperHead Visa mounted on the camera, where up to two channels of IFB audio are de-embedded for crew communications.

Like the other members of the CopperHead line of camera-mounted transceivers, the CopperHead Visa mounts quickly and easily to any professional camera's battery interface system including Anton-Bauer®, "V"-Mount, or PAG.
